If you are "seeing" the address at your web server, then it's the IP address of the firewall. Keep in mind that some ISPs / companies use multiple firewalls for load balancing, and since HTTP is a "connection less" protocol you could see all the firewall IPs during a single page request. You might have better luck expanding your check to the first three octets of the IP address.
